"Ira sent a team of guys (3) to the house as scheduled and they went right to work. I had cleaned out most of the garage so they were able to start quickly. They used a machine to grind the garage floor to bare concrete. The garage had lots of cracks so they filled them in with an epoxy crack filler. Once this was done and dry they rolled on the base color. They rolled the top coat and threw the flakes on the floor. Scraped the excess flakes off and i think another top coat, can't remember exactly. I went with the Poly Aspartic system since it was a one day process over the epoxy system which would have been 3-4 days. Yes it was a bit more expensive but the results are great and it has a great warranty. IMPORTANT NOTE -  the stuff really smells and since it's in your garage it will seep into your house. Be prepared to deal with the smell for about a day, we left the garage door open a crack over several nights to help with the smell. I could walk on it within a couple of hours and parked the car on it the following day. Looks awesome.About a week later they came to start on the driveway, walkway and lania. They pressure washed one day and started the work the following day. They put down the base coat, we selected a two color acrylic system with a template design. After that the stencil was laid down followed by the top coat being applied by sprayer. This was all done by 2 guys, they'd been doing this for quite some time, you could tell. After the top coat dried they removed the stencil and you could see the design and colors. Once all was cleaned up from overspray they applied two coats of sealer. WARNING.... this stuff smells real bad, worse than the garage!!!! My wife and child had to leave one night because of the smell. All in all the driveway and lanai look great. Have received lots of comments from neighbors wanting to do the same to their house. I'll try and figure out how to add photos here soon."

FAQs for concrete delivery projects in Dunedin, FL

The amount of concrete you need varies by project. One 80lb bag covers an area of about 2 square feet, for a slab 4 inches thick. Two 60lb bags of concrete cover an area of about 2 square feet for a slab that is 6 inches thick.

A truckload of concrete can usually hold a maximum of 10 cubic yards.

The cost of concrete per cubic yard depends on which brand you purchase, but usually costs about $110 for bags.

It takes about 41 bags of concrete to fill a cubic yard. Always plan to buy a few bags more than the exact required amount in case of mistakes.

To calculate the amount of concrete you need for a slab, you should find the cubic yardage of the area you will be filling. Just follow these steps:

  1. Measure the area in feet.

  2. Multiply length by width, and then by thickness.

  3. Divide the resulting number by 27 to find cubic yards.
